Deut 17:6 NLT
But never put a person to death on the testimony of only one witness. There must always be two or three witnesses.
Deut 19:15 NLT
"You must not convict anyone of a crime on the testimony of only one witness. The facts of the case must be established by the testimony of two or three witnesses.
1 Tim 5:19 NKJV
Do not receive an accusation against an elder except from two or three witnesses.
1 Tim 5:19 NLT
Do not listen to an accusation against an elder unless it is confirmed by two or three witnesses.
